Open in Google MapsBuying Property in Greece
Purchasing property in Greece involves multiple legal steps including obtaining a Greek tax number, engaging professionals, and completing due diligence checks. Buyers should expect to budget for various fees, approximately 6-10% on top of the purchase price.
Property purchase processes in Greece can vary across regions, especially regarding restrictions for non-EU buyers in border areas. It is crucial to work closely with a qualified local lawyer to ensure compliance with the latest legal requirements and tax implications.
